Professional Tax

Professional Tax is a state-level tax levied on individuals and businesses based on their income or profession. In India, it is typically paid by employees, self-employed professionals, and business owners. The tax amount varies depending on the state and income level and is deducted from the salary or paid directly by individuals.

Salary or Wages under purview of Profession Tax

The profession tax payable by an employee is to be deducted by employer from salary and wage payable to the employee as per Profession Tax Act.
